Key Features of the iPollo X1
- Hashrate: 300-330 MH/s (±5%)
- Power Consumption: 240W (±10%)
- Memory: 6.0 GB (5.8 GB available)
- Dimensions: 300 x 100 x 50 mm
- Weight: 1.6 kg
- Noise Level: ~50 dB
- Supported Cryptocurrencies: ETC, ETHF, QKC, CLO, POM, ZIL
The iPollo X1 is available in two configurations: the Standard Edition, which includes the core mining unit and power supply, and the Advanced Edition, which features an Orange Pi set for standalone operation. This flexibility allows miners to choose the setup that best suits their needs.

2. Electricity Costs
With a power consumption of just 240W, the iPollo X1 is one of the most energy-efficient mining devices on the market. However, electricity costs can vary significantly depending on your location. To estimate your monthly electricity expense, use the following formula:
Monthly Electricity Cost = Power Consumption (kW) × Hours of Operation × Electricity Rate (per kWh)
For example, if your electricity rate is $0.12 per kWh and you operate the iPollo X1 24/7: 0.24 kW × 720 hours × $0.12 = $20.16 per month

Profitability Analysis
When evaluating the profitability of the iPollo X1, several factors come into play, including mining rewards, electricity costs, and market conditions. Here’s a step-by-step analysis to help you understand the potential returns on your investment.
1. Hashrate and Mining Rewards
The iPollo X1 boasts a hashrate of 300-330 MH/s, making it a competitive option for Ethash-based cryptocurrencies. To estimate your daily mining rewards, you can use online mining calculators, which take into account factors like network difficulty and block rewards.
For example, let’s assume the current network difficulty for Ethereum Classic (ETC) is 20 TH, and the block reward is 2.56 ETC. Based on these parameters, the iPollo X1 could generate approximately 0.02 ETC per day.
2. Electricity Costs vs. Mining Revenue
Using the earlier electricity cost estimate of $20.16 per month, let’s calculate the net profit. If the current price of ETC is $30, your daily revenue would be:
0.02 ETC × $30 = $0.60 per day
Monthly revenue: $0.60 × 30 = $18.00
Subtracting the electricity cost: $18.00 – $20.16 = -$2.16
In this scenario, the operation appears to be slightly unprofitable. However, profitability can fluctuate based on market prices, network difficulty, and electricity rates.
